Instructions

Turn each image into a sound, and string these sounds together to make the answer.
They are already in the proper sequential order, top to bottom.


It usually helps to think of several possible sounds for each image, along with any tangential phonetic associations or pieces. Each image usually represents one or two syllables. These are the tidbits of answer that you collect.
Once the bits have been collected, you see what can be arranged...
